Where is the Beardell family from?

You can see how Beardell families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Beardell family name was found in the USA, and the UK between 1891 and 1920. The most Beardell families were found in USA in 1920, and United Kingdom in 1891. In 1891 there were 2 Beardell families living in London. This was about 50% of all the recorded Beardell's in United Kingdom. London and 1 other county had the highest population of Beardell families in 1891.
